How Mancef S 250mg/125mg Injection works:
Ceftriaxone/Sulbactam injection (Mancef S 250mg/125mg) unites a cephalosporin antibiotic (Ceftriaxone) with a beta-lactamase inhibitor (Sulbactam). Ceftriaxone's mechanism involves disrupting bacterial cell wall synthesis, hindering bacterial survival. Sulbactam counteracts bacterial resistance mechanisms, thereby augmenting Ceftriaxone's antibacterial effect.
